Thay đổi thứ tự khởi động Grub


-2

Máy tính của tôi có ba ổ đĩa trong đó:

  • Ổ cứng 3 TB được định dạng là EXT4 cho Ubuntu 17.04
  • Ổ cứng 640 GB được định dạng là NTFS cho Windows 10
  • SSD 60 GB hiện được định dạng là NTFS để đọc trò chơi nhanh trên Windows

Tôi muốn làm gì

  1. Tôi muốn cài đặt grub trên SSD để khởi động nhanh
  2. Thay đổi thứ tự tự động của grub để khi tôi khởi động, nó tự động khởi động vào Windows thay vì Ubuntu
  3. Có thể thay đổi thứ tự khởi động từ Windows hoặc Ubuntu

Điều này có thể không? Tôi có thể tưởng tượng # 3 sẽ khó nhất vì Windows không thích bất cứ thứ gì ngoài Fat32 / NTFS, nhưng nếu có, hãy cho tôi biết.


2
Cài đặt grub vào SSD sẽ không ảnh hưởng đến tốc độ khởi động của Ubuntu hoặc Windows. Để cải thiện tốc độ khởi động, bạn sẽ cần cài đặt cả hai hệ điều hành trên SSD.
mikewhthing 4/10/17

Câu trả lời:


4

1) Grub chỉ cung cấp tùy chọn khởi động và khởi chạy trình tải khởi động thích hợp.
Do đó, việc đặt nó vào SSD sẽ không tăng tốc độ khởi động do quá trình khởi động thực tế được thực hiện từ ổ đĩa có HĐH trên đó.

2) Chỉnh sửa / etc / default / grub. Thay đổi GRUB_DEFAULT=0để trỏ đến mục menu bạn muốn được mặc định.
Ví dụ:GRUB_DEFAULT="Windows 7 (loader) (on /dev/sda2)"

3) Windows không thể thay đổi thứ tự khởi động grub.


1
@MarkKirby không thay đổi thứ tự khởi động như được lưu trong Ubuntu. Khởi động từ Ubuntu khởi động mặc định như được lưu trong Ubuntu.
Rinzwind

2
  1. Để khởi động nhanh hơn ... giả sử rằng Ubuntu là hệ điều hành chính của bạn ... với cấu hình của bạn ... cách tốt nhất bạn có thể làm là cài đặt Ubuntu trên SSD, nhưng với thư mục / home trên ổ cứng 3TB. Đảm bảo rằng bạn đã định dạng ổ đĩa 3TB bằng bảng phân vùng gpt, vì nó có kích thước hơn 2TB. Bạn cũng có thể phân vùng 3TB với phân vùng NTFS bổ sung để bạn có thể dễ dàng chia sẻ tệp giữa Windows và Ubuntu.

  2. Xem mục số 3, bên dưới.

  3. Nếu bạn chỉnh sửa /etc/default/grubvới các cài đặt sau, nó sẽ ghi nhớ HĐH cuối cùng bạn đã khởi động và đó sẽ trở thành HĐH mặc định cho các lần khởi động trong tương lai.

Trong terminal...

gksudo gedit /etc/default/grub

thêm / thay đổi những dòng này ở gần đầu tập tin ...

GRUB_DEFAULT=saved
GRUB_SAVEDEFAULT=true

lưu tập tin và thoát gedit. Sau đó...

sudo update-grub

Thật không may, câu trả lời không còn được áp dụng. Ổ cứng của tôi đã khởi động nó và tôi phải gỡ cài đặt Ubuntu ngay bây giờ ..
David
Khi sử dụng trang web của chúng tôi, bạn xác nhận rằng bạn đã đọc và hiểu Chính sách cookieChính sách bảo mật của chúng tôi.
Licensed under cc by-sa 3.0 with attribution required.